Electric cars changed not just how we drive but how we insure. As EV adoption accelerated, insurers had to price a new kind of risk — expensive battery packs, specialised repairs and advanced sensors — and a dedicated EV insurance market emerged. This electric car insurance cost timeline traces that evolution from the 1997 Toyota Prius and the first hybrid underwriting, through the arrival of the Nissan Leaf and Tesla, to today’s battery-protection add-ons, telematics pricing and AI-assisted claims. Figures are drawn from industry reports and insurer and regulator disclosures, always tied to a specific market and time period, with editorial analysis kept separate from verified data.
Electric car insurance covers EVs against accidents, theft and third-party liability, plus EV-specific risks like battery, charger and charging-equipment damage. It has historically cost more than petrol-car cover — roughly 15–25% more in the UK and around 20–25% more in India in 2026, and higher in the US by some reports — mainly because batteries are expensive to replace and EV repairs need specialised centres. The gap is narrowing as repair networks, data and competition grow. Manufacturer battery warranties cover defects and degradation; insurance covers accidental damage. Premiums vary by car, driver, location and insurer, so always compare current quotes.

Reverse chronological — latest developments first, the 1997 hybrid era last.
Insurance development: insurers scaled AI-assisted claims, connected-car telematics and usage-based insurance, and began using battery state-of-health (SoH) data in pricing and settlements. Regulatory change: in India, industry reports say the IRDAI is moving toward a dedicated EV motor-insurance product line that would standardise battery and charging-equipment cover (an expected development, not yet a final rule).
Cost impact: the EV-versus-petrol premium gap continued to narrow in 2026 as repair data, parts supply and competition matured, even as EV adoption widened beyond big cities in India.
Insurance development: insurers broadened battery-protection add-ons (water ingress, charging surge, consequential damage) and rolled out subscription and usage-based options; better ADAS data started to improve pricing for well-equipped models. Consumer benefit: EV owners gained more tailored cover and, for careful drivers, the chance to lower premiums through telematics.
Market data: EV insurance was one of the fastest-growing motor segments, but premiums also peaked relative to petrol — industry reports put average EV cover roughly 25% above equivalent petrol cars in some markets at the 2024 peak (higher for certain US models). Insurance development: insurer competition and repair-network expansion then began pushing costs back down.
Insurance development: insurers launched dedicated EV insurance products with EV-specific add-ons — charging-equipment protection for home wallboxes and portable chargers, and battery cover — alongside faster digital claim processing. Consumer benefit: EV owners could finally buy cover designed for their car rather than a petrol policy with gaps.
Insurance development: as mass-market EVs surged — Tesla’s Safety Score telematics pricing arrived in 2021, and India’s Tata Nexon EV built momentum — insurers deepened telematics adoption and started integrating battery warranties with cover to clarify who pays for what. Cost impact: richer driving and repair data began to make EV pricing more accurate.
Insurer / product: Tesla launched its own Tesla Insurance in 2019 (starting in California), arguing it understood its cars and repair costs better than traditional insurers. Insurance development: specialised EV repair networks and battery-handling protocols expanded, and battery accidental-damage cover became more clearly defined. Cost impact: pricing remained high while claims data was still thin.
EV market: the Nissan Leaf (2010) brought the first mass-market battery EV, followed by the Tesla Model S (2012). Insurance development: with little claims history, insurers priced early EVs cautiously — sometimes higher — and treated the battery as the dominant risk. Consumer benefit: early adopters got cover, but often paid a premium for the unknown.
EV market: the Toyota Prius launched in 1997, bringing hybrids to the mass market, and the Tesla Roadster arrived in 2008. Insurance development: insurers began underwriting hybrid and early electric powertrains, learning how to value battery and electronic components — the foundation of modern EV insurance. Why it matters: the pricing questions raised here — battery cost, specialised repair — still shape EV premiums today.
The main reasons EV premiums have run above petrol cars.
These factors are why EV cover has cost more, but they are easing: as repair networks grow, technicians are trained and claims data accumulates, the premium gap has been shrinking (industry reports, 2024–2026).
What a modern EV policy can include (availability and names vary by market and insurer).
| Cover | What it does |
|---|---|
| Third-party liability | Legally required in most markets; pays for injury or damage you cause to others |
| Comprehensive (own-damage) | Covers accidental damage, fire and theft of your EV, plus third-party liability |
| Battery protection | Add-on for battery risks such as water ingress, short circuit and charging surge |
| Charging equipment cover | Protects home wallbox, cables and portable chargers |
| Zero depreciation | Pays claims without deducting depreciation on parts (popular EV add-on in India) |
| Roadside assistance | Help for breakdowns, including towing a flat-battery EV to a charger |
| Personal accident cover | Compensation for the owner-driver in case of injury or death |
| Consumables / motor cover | Covers items like coolant and, in some products, the electric motor |

Illustrative industry-report figures — not quotes. Always cite the market and period, as costs differ widely.
| Market | EV vs petrol gap | Note |
|---|---|---|
| United Kingdom | ~15–25% more | 2026 reports; gap narrowed from ~25% at the 2024 peak |
| United States | Higher; ~$3,159/yr full cover vs ~$2,218 gas | 2026 (Insurify); larger gap on older models, smaller on new |
| India | ~20–25% more | 2026; comprehensive commonly ₹10,000–50,000/yr by model |
Figures are drawn from 2026 industry reports (including MoneyGeek, Insurify and Indian motor-insurance guides) and are averages, not personalised quotes. Your premium depends on the exact model, IDV or sum insured, location, driver profile, claims history and insurer.
A crucial distinction EV owners often miss.
| Aspect | Battery warranty | Insurance |
|---|---|---|
| Provided by | Vehicle manufacturer | Insurer |
| Covers | Manufacturing defects & capacity loss below a set threshold | Accidental, external & specified damage |
| Typical term | Often around 8 years / set km | Annual, renewable |
| Does not cover | Crashes, water, misuse | Normal gradual degradation |
| Best for | Long-term battery health | Accidents, theft, third-party |
Check your specific warranty document and policy wording — terms, thresholds and exclusions vary by manufacturer, insurer and market.
A general guide — compare current quotes for your exact car and profile.
1. Pick the cover level. Third-party is the legal minimum in most markets; comprehensive (own-damage plus liability) is strongly recommended for an expensive EV. 2. Compare quotes. Use insurers and aggregators (such as Policybazaar in India) to compare for your exact model, location and driver profile. 3. Add EV-specific cover. Consider battery protection, charging-equipment cover, zero depreciation and roadside assistance with flat-battery towing. 4. Check IDV/sum insured and exclusions. Confirm the insured value and read what the battery cover does and does not include. 5. Buy and keep documents. Retain the policy and service records; a clean claims history lowers future premiums. Premiums vary, so re-compare at each renewal.
| Myth | Fact |
|---|---|
| “EV insurance is always far more expensive.” | It has cost more, but the gap is narrowing and varies widely by model, market and driver. |
| “The battery warranty covers accident damage.” | Warranties cover defects and degradation, not crashes, water or misuse — that is what insurance is for. |
| “Every small bump means a new battery.” | Not always; many minor knocks are repaired, but casing damage can force a pack replacement. |
| “Home chargers are automatically covered.” | Charging equipment often needs a specific add-on; older policies may exclude it. |
| “All insurers price EVs the same.” | Premiums vary significantly between insurers, which is why comparing quotes matters. |
